Former World Champion Rocky Lockridge has passed away aged 60, his family confirming the news today.
Complications following a stroke suffered a while ago was reportedly the cause.
In the ’80s Lockridge captured the WBA and IBF titles at Super Featherweight, his first coming against Roger Mayweather in 1984 whilst his next came courtesy of the stoppage of Barry Michael.
In his time, Lockridge faced some great fighters, names such as Julio Cesar Chavez, Wilfredo Gomez, Tony Lopez and who could forget his memorable fights with Eusebio Pedroza.
Rocky’s son Ricky Lockridge confirmed his father’s passing and said, “It is with great pain but a whole heart that I tell you family and friends that my father Ricky Lockridge aka Rocky Lockridge has passed away.”
“All he wanted was to be in the comfort of his home with friends/ family. God has called him to walk through the gates of heaven.”
Lockridge had reportedly been in hospital care for the past few weeks.
